Blanche "of the Tower" Plantagenet

(Abt Mar 1342 - Abt Mar 1342)

==Biography==Blanche of the Tower (born and died March 1342 Tower of London).Richardson, D. (n.d.). Royal Ancestry, I, pp. 88; Cawley, 2006. [http://fmg.ac/Projects/MedLands/ENGLAND,%20Kings%201066-1603.htm#_ftnref954]
bur. Westminster Abbey.[http://fmg.ac/Projects/MedLands/ENGLAND,%20Kings%201066-1603.htm#_ftnref951]
Blanche is the eighth child of [[Plantagenet-70 | Edward III]], King of England and Philippa of Hainault. [http://fmg.ac/Projects/MedLands/ENGLAND,%20Kings%201066-1603.htm#EdwardIIIdied1377B][http://fmg.ac/Projects/MedLands/HAINAUT.htm#PhilippaHainautdied1369] Her joint tomb with her brother William now stands in St. Edmund's Chapel, Westminster, beside that of another prince, John of Eltham. The joint tomb appears to have been executed as late as 1376 when John Orchard was paid for supplying 'two images of alabaster placed upon a small marble tomb for an infant son and daughter of the Queen.' }
